50 years of Chichester Festival Theatre

The Society has managed to obtain tickets for three productions in this special year.

All evening performances!

The first is the Opening production of

Chekhov’s UNCLE VANYA translated by Michael Frayn

This play opened the very first season 50 years ago with a cast including

Olivier, Redgrave, Plowright & the Thorndykes
